Overview

Postcode S70 4NA is located in a minor urban area, within the Kingstone ward of Barnsley in the Yorkshire and The Humber region, and forms part of the Worsbrough Common area. It has very high deprivation and very high crime levels, with around 101.3 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, about 10% below the Yorkshire and The Humber average of 113 per 1,000. The average income per household in Worsbrough Common is £32,979 per year. The nearest station is Barnsley, about 0.7 miles away. There are 9 primary and 1 secondary schools in the area. There is 1 park nearby, the closest large park is Locke Park.
